Par. 5. The narrator says, "Her name sprang to my lips at moments in strange prayers and praises..." With what earlier word is the word prayers most closely associated? (Araby by James Joyce).

A. Labourers

B. Image

C. Ballad

D. Flaring

E. Romance

Final answer:

In 'Araby' by James Joyce, the word 'prayers' links with 'romance' as the narrator’s feelings for Mangan's sister are portrayed with a religious-like devotion.

Step-by-step explanation:

In the context of James Joyce's Araby and the given passage, the word "prayers" is most closely associated with the word "romance" (E). This association arises because the narrator's adoration for Mangan's sister is depicted with language that imbues the sentiment with the qualities of a religious experience or devotion, thereby linking his feelings to both prayer and romance.
